Ohio man gets 17 years for leaving 2 kids in trash

DAYTON, Ohio (AP) — A U.S. man who left an infant and a toddler in a plastic trash bin on a hot July day has been sentenced to 17 years in prison.

Tommie Johnson Jr., 39, cried and apologized Wednesday before his sentencing.

Prosecutors say Johnson put the 8-month-old boy and 2-year-old girl in the trash after a dispute with their mother and later told police officers he had intended to retrieve them. Two electricians rescued the thirsty, hungry children about 13 hours later after hearing them cry.

Johnson pleaded no contest about two weeks ago to attempted murder, kidnapping, domestic violence and tampering with evidence.

The children are in the custody of a welfare agency.
